Prest Avenue is in Meden Vale, Mansfield and in Mansfield district. NG20 9PQ is located in the Netherfield elect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Mansfield.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ding NG20 9PQ,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.4%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around NG20 9PQ this area, 29.4%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 13.1%.

Safety

Is Prest Avenue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Prest Avenue was 58.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 37.8% lower than the Market Warsop average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Prest Avenue has the 20th lowest crime rate of 41 local areas in Market Warsop and the 138th lowest crime rate of 318 local areas in Mansfield .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 24.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-40.4%.
